adv. Obs. rare1. [f. EMBRYONATE a. + -LY2.] In an embryonate manner: as an embryo.
1665. G. Harvey, Advice agst. Plague, 6. That those Pestilential fumes be first embryonately or preparatively formed in a close thick or standing air.
